I just had a visit with a new mom - baby was born 6/30/98, at
34 weeks gestation after treatment (of mom) with
betamethazone and magnesium sulfate. Baby was 5# 6 oz. at
birth and went home with mom in 48 hours. Baby latched well
right after birth and seemed to nurse well in hospital
(according to mom).
Baby was re-admitted at 9 days old, weight 3# 14 oz. - mom
had been exclusively breastfeeding. Baby had had only one
bowel movement (at 8 days old) and few wet diapers. BAby
fed ABM in hospital - mom pumped with double electric pump
and got NOTHING!.
Baby now 17 days old, weighs 5# 2 oz. Mom is feeding 40cc
of ABM every 3 hours with bottle. She puts the baby to breast
before each feeding....baby latches well (I observed feeding),
but tired quickly. Mom pumps (only 3 times daily, I instructed
her to increase that!), and gets nothing. I did a before and
after weght today and it showed 0 intake.
Mom is going to buy SNS...........she is taking 3 capsules of
Fenugreek 3 times a day (started 2 days ago).
Does Mag. Sulfate affect milk "coming in"?
What else would you advise for this mom??
